"Many people connected to the internet for the first time as they adapted to the challenges of COVID-19, while existing users embraced new digital tools and rediscovered old favourites. As a result, many of the indicators in our Global Digital Reports have seen remarkable levels of growth over the past 12 months. Social media delivered some of the most impressive numbers, with users increasing by more than 13 percent since our 2020 reports. Almost half a billion users joined social media in the past year, taking the global total to 4.2 billion in early 2021. Growth hasn’t just been about user numbers, though. The world’s mobile users now spend more time on their phones than they do watching television, clearly positioning the smartphone as today’s ‘first screen’. Ecommerce is another area that saw rapid growth in 2020, with many people moving their shopping online to mitigate the health risks associated with COVID-19. However, research suggests that the new ecommerce habits people adopted during lockdown will last well beyond the pandemic." (Page 3)
